SABIC — Verified Employer Profile
SABIC (Saudi Basic Industries Corporation), now majority-owned by Saudi Aramco, operates 50+ manufacturing and research facilities across the globe with its digital and IT command centre in Riyadh. Its cybersecurity and IT function faces the dual challenge of securing legacy OT environments across manufacturing plants while accelerating a SAP S/4HANA-led digital transformation across 33,000+ employees worldwide.

SABIC hires are typically based in Riyadh's King Abdullah Financial District or its Al Nakheel campus — a central, international environment. However, the disconnect between Riyadh's social infrastructure and manufacturing-site rotations to Jubail Industrial City creates adjustment fatigue in the first year, particularly for candidates expecting a purely urban assignment.
